The Georgetown Hoyas will celebrate their first practice of the 2011/12 season with their annual Midnight Madness event Thursday evening at McDonough Arena at 8:30 PM; the school will also stream the event live and free of charge at GUHoyas.com.
Students wishing to attend Midnight Madness need to arrive at 6 PM, when the school will distribute wristbands for entry. As an added incentive to come out early, Georgetown will provide free food to the first 250 students to arrive. In addition, all students will receive "a Georgetown Basketball T-shirt, a lighted rally towel and a drawstring backpack (courtesy of Capital One)," according to the school. The doors open at 8 PM.
The school touts performances by its step team, a "special musical performer," and its cheer squad. Former Hoyas star Greg Monroe, now of the Detroit Pistons, will be honored.
The men's basketball team will cap the evening with a dunk exhibition and a series of drills.
